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- An observation mission of the Shanghai Cooperation Organization (SCO) stated that the presidential elections in Uzbekistan, which were held on 29 March, complied to the electoral legislation of Uzbekistan.
The mission said that its observers visited polling stations in Tashkent city, Bukhara, Samarkand and Tashkent regions. The mission received full information on candidates and their pre-election programme.
The SCO mission stated that it recorded no violation of regulation on use of mass media by candidates during agitation period.
The mission underlined high political activity of population. The mission said that the elections were held strictly with legislation of Uzbekistan. There were no complaints from people or political parties, it added.
